Our client in the South West of England is recruiting for a Principal Environmental Health Officer to lead and manage an Environmental Protection team on an interim basis.
You will be responsible for providing an effective and comprehensive, customer-focused service in accordance with legislation and agreed service standards acting as lead officer for Environmental Protection (environmental/animal activities permits, air quality, community protection, noise and other statutory nuisance, national assistance funerals, bathing water quality, contaminated land, pest control, found dogs, and planning/licensing consultations) matters.
About you
You must possess an in-depth understanding of the effective application of related legislation and enforcement processes and be qualified, as a minimum, to the equivalent of Environmental Health Officer level – ideally, you will be a member of the CIEH. In addition, you will hold an ILM level 5 or equivalent qualification in management or have equivalent experience. Recent experience of delivering a similar service; managing and motivating a team; and reviewing, developing, implementing and monitoring environmental health policy and strategy are also essential. You will also be adept at utilising technology for service delivery and able to make timely and confident decisions on complex matters as well as having excellent communication and influencing skills.
